Chapter 39
Transcript from NBC Nightly News, senior foreign political analyst Thomas Yearns reporting.
Tonight, in a stunning turn of events, the two religious terrorists who have plagued the Middle East for the past three and a half years have been killed. Facts are sketchy at best, but initial reports reveal a highly trained special forces unit of the United Arab/Aryan Brotherhood carried out a covert operation, which resulted in the death of both individuals.
The attack took place in Jerusalem on the corner of Rashba Street and Ramban Street near the Israeli Parliamentary Building at a little after nine o’clock local time.
Both bodies remain in the street, and bystanders have gathered to celebrate. Images of the scene have already been broadcast via satellite around the globe.
The man and woman, now reported to be Andrew Mayer and Melissa Abramov, both of Jewish descent but American citizens, began their reign of terror three and a half years ago with a series of gruesome murders. The pair is reportedly responsible for the deaths of over a hundred and sixty individuals over that period of time. They were also reportedly responsible for destructive weather patterns and phenomena around the world that claimed the lives of many more. Sources tell me the plot to capture or kill the duo has been in the planning stages for months, and many believe the attack came much too late.
Most believe this marks an important date for not only the Middle East but also for the world. While the instigators were successful in getting some to follow their teachings of hate and intolerance, most of the world’s citizens viewed them as terrorists of the most heinous kind. There is already talk of establishing this day as a worldwide holiday.
As always, we will continue to keep you updated as these events unfold. But for now, rest well and know that the world is a safer place.
Reporting from Jerusalem, Thomas Yearns.
Chapter 40
Transcript from British News Corporation, Headline News, world news correspondent Jamie Butler reporting.
The world is in shock. Utter shock. The two international terrorists known by some as “The Witnesses” are alive. I repeat—it is midnight here in Jerusalem and they are alive.
Killed three and a half days ago by special forces in a highly covert and well-planned attack, the duo’s bodies lay at the corner of Rashba and Ramban Streets in Jerusalem, located right behind me, untouched. So hated were they that their bodies were left to rot, many thinking they were not worthy of even an improper burial.
If you look just over my right shoulder, you can see the two standing almost motionless, faces turned skyward. They’ve been like that for nearly thirty minutes now. And, as you can see, a very hostile crowd has gathered around them. Fear is thick in this Jerusalem air. The terrorists are responsible for numerous deaths both in America and here in Israel, and the world celebrated when they were killed.
And now, inexplicably, they are alive.
The duo, recently identified as—
Oh, wait . . . what is happening? John, are you getting this?
For those viewing at home, John, our cameraman will attempt to capture what we are seeing in the sky above Jerusalem.
Are you getting it?
A massive storm front has just rolled in. The clouds . . . they’re boiling, churning. I’ve never seen anything like this.
Bloody . . . the clouds are parting. They are parting, just rolling back like a wave.
John, John! The ground. Look what’s happening. This is bloody unbelievable. The pair has lifted off the ground. Their feet are not on the ground. They are rising into the air. Ten meters, fifteen meters, twenty, thirty . . . Oh bloody sh—
[Loses transmission of video and audio]
John, did you get it? Did you get that?
The duo rose slowly into the air and then . . . just . . . I don’t even know how to explain it . . . they were gone, like they grew bloody rocket boosters on the bottoms of their feet and shot straight up through the hole in the clouds.
I have never seen anything like this, John. I’ve never seen anything like this. I’m sweating, crying, shaking all over. This is bloody incredible. If I hadn’t seen it with my own eyes, I would say anyone reporting this was bloody crazy. But I’m not crazy. Am I? John, am I crazy? You saw it too, right? Did you get it?
The scene here is one of utter panic and chaos. The crowd on the street has mostly dispersed, most running from the scene. I . . . I can’t believe what I just witnessed.
Uh, uh, reporting live from Jerusalem. Jamie, uh . . . this is bloody nuts. I don’t even remember my own name.
